How do I hear the transmitted FT8 or RTTY signal that I am sending?
I have a 6400M. But I noticed this evening when I transmit FT8, I can not hear the transmitted signal. And this occurs with RTTY also. I know there is a monitor button on SmartSDR, but I pushed that in and still didn't hear anything. To be honest the only functions of SmartSDR that I use is CAT and DAX. And yet, I can hear my CW sidetone when I transmit CW.

I found out that when one pushes one time the power button why operating a digital mode and menu comes up and there is a MON with slider to the right of that. I pressed it in and transmitted FT8 and I heard the transmit signal.
